On , OSHA opened a programmed Related safety inspection of LCG WELDING, LLC in 13325 FLAMINGO CROSSINGS BLVD, KISSIMMEE, FL 34747 (NAICS 333992). OSHA activity number 344904065.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

Citations
2 citations on file for this inspection.
1926.502 B02
- Issued
- Jan 25, 2021
- Penalty
- Initial $4,096 · Current $2,458 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.502(b)(2): Midrails, screens, mesh, intermediate vertical members, or equivalent intermediate structure members were not installed between the top edge of the guardrail system and the walking/working surface when there was no wall or parapet wall at least 21 inches (53 cm) high. At the site - Building 1900 North West Stairwell 3rd Floor, an employee was sitting in front of a an opening unguarded by a guardrail system that was missing the mid rail, creating a 20 fall hazard, on or about 8/25/2020.

1926.1053 B06
- Issued
- Jan 25, 2021
- Penalty
- Initial $4,096 · Current $2,458 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(6): Ladders were used on surfaces which were not stable and level: At the site - building 1900 North West Stairwell an employee was using a A-Frame ladder on stairs not at the same elevation level, creating a 6 feet fall hazard, on or about 8/25/2020.
